Transaction 6ecda17232fba2c8d268f8833dfcec50c7e8928c464003ab556d705661300659
1 Input
2 Outputs
- 6ecda17232fba2c8d268f8833dfcec50c7e8928c464003ab556d705661300659:0
- 6ecda17232fba2c8d268f8833dfcec50c7e8928c464003ab556d705661300659:1
value 10695503
address 1EfnoCUNCdtwqt88vhPajRaJZX7RJMTxRe
value 18578201
address 125N6Fq99ozomGDnqJrjoxVKuiSLnx2Ckv